I am a senior lecturer in social science specializing in international migration, integration, sustainable development, and gender studies. My research focuses on migration, identity, spatial belonging, but also gender and sustainability. I have taught a wide range of courses at undergraduate and postgraduate levels, including Sweden in a Post-Colonial WorldTheories of International RelationsGlocal Challenges, and Sustainable Development and Ethics, Political Perspectives of Gender and Sexuality. I have also coordinated master’s programs and contributed to curriculum development, fostering inclusive and engaging learning environments. 

At University West, I have been a member of the Center for Sustainability, where I collaborate with stakeholders to address sustainability challenges. I have also served on the university’s working group for gender mainstreaming and equal terms, contributing to initiatives that promote inclusivity and equity in education and research.
